West Texas mom arrested for posing as her teen daughter at school

The mother of a 13-year-old girl in West Texas has been arrested for posing as her daughter and spending a day at her middle school.

Casey Garcia, 30, posted video of the trip on YouTube.

Garcia's daughter attends Garcia-Enriquez Middle School in San Elizario, about 10 miles southeast of El Paso. Garcia recorded video of herself throughout the day on her phone.

"Oh my God. I'm going to get so caught," Garcia says near the beginning of the six minute video. "I'm actually really scared now."

Garcia says she was testing security at the school. The video shows her sitting in classes and teachers greeting her by her daughter's name.

Near the end of the day, a teacher taking attendance notices she is not a student.

"I finally got caught," she said in the video. "I told them I would go to the principal's office, so I guess we're going to see what happens."

Garcia also recorded video of El Paso County sheriff's deputies coming to her home. She was arrested on charges of criminal trespass and tampering with government records. Garcia has since posted bond.

The superintendent of San Elizario ISD says local authorities are handling the case. Jeannie Mesa-Chavez says the district is also reviewing security measures.
